Fortified with the Sacraments of Holy Mother Church, Betty Ann Huber, 88, of Perryville, Missouri passed away surrounded by her loving family on Monday, June 12, 2023, at Independence Care Center in Perryville, MO.
She was born October 26, 1934, in Ste. Genevieve, MO to Fred and Hilda (Roth) Rottler.
Betty and Melvin J. Huber were married June 27, 1959, at Church of Ste. Genevieve in Ste. Genevieve, MO. He preceded her in death on February 7, 2009.
Betty was a dedicated homemaker. After raising her children, she worked for over 16 years as a sales clerk at Hoeckele’s Bakery & Deli.
She was a member of St. Vincent de Paul Catholic Church, Ladies Sodality, Ladies of Charity, Miraculous Medal Association, volunteer at St. Vincent de Paul Thrift Store and Food Pantry, and Adorer of the Blessed Sacrament at St. Vincent de Paul Adoration Chapel. Betty was a past member of Tuesday morning Ladies Bowling League.
Betty enjoyed gardening, and cooking for her family. She loved spending time with her children, grandchildren and great grandchildren.
